There were nine Armenian nationals in the minibus that crashed into a Kamaz truck in Tula Oblast in Russia on June 18, Arkmenia’s Ministry of health reports. Two of them were children.

The injured were taken to hospitals in Stupino and Tula. They were all examined and rendered medical care. Three of them have been discharged from hospital.

The Ministry of Health maintains constant contact with the medical institutions of the Russian Federation.

There were 20 passengers in the minibus during the accident.
